The updated flagship model will now feature the company’s latest Full LED Matrix Headlights. Making the Superb the first-ever production model of Skoda to get the technology. Revealing the concept, Skoda has released a set of images that tell you a lot about fancy tech. We get a first impression of the new full-LED Matrix headlights, the redesigned LED fog lights and full LED tail lights with dynamic indicators. The automaker also showcases the tech through a new video.

The sketch shows the design of the new lighting system. It consists of an LED module for the dipped and high beam as well as three further LED high beam segments, and bears the Skoda Crystal Lighting’ lettering in the housings.

Salient Features:

  • A narrow strip of LEDs provides the indicators, daytime running lights and position light.
  • Above this are fine needle-like LED structures, which are part of the new animated Coming/Leaving Home function.
  • When turning on and turning off the car, this feature automatically turns elements of the headlights and tail lights on and off in a specified sequence.
  • New full-LED Matrix headlights and the Coming/Leaving Home animation in action and illustrates how they work.
  • Redesigned fog lights featuring LED technology and the full LED taillights
  • Dynamic indicators that illuminate in an outward sweeping motion. Not only do these provide a more dynamic appearance, but they are also more noticeable for other road users and increase road traffic safety.
